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
346 396782 1267 138297
7784296752 51012260859 46
7784296752 51012260859 46
8368523 07730 88689024236
All about undefined
Interested in learning more?
7784296752 51012260859 46
8368523 07730 88689024236
See more
72 1083568
921 565345 445583056
See more
146 5191184889 92920371147
94017 3614330052 3749431240
See more